2021 Nonfiction Contest Winners
Winner - jj PEña
“You left us like winter”
JJ Peña (pronouns he/they) is a queer, burrito-blooded writer. JJ's work is included in the Best Microfiction 2020 anthology & Wigleaf’s Top 50 (Very) Short Fictions (2020). JJ is a 2021 Periplus fellow, holds a BA in both English and Anthropology, and an MFA in Creative Writing from the University of Texas at El Paso. JJ's stories have appeared or are forthcoming in Washington Square Review, Cincinnati Review, Massachusetts Review, & elsewhere. JJ serves as a flash fiction reader for Split Lip magazine
RUNNER UP - Linda Petrucelli
“Countdown”
Linda Petrucelli (she/her) is a writer obsessed with short form fiction and CNF. Her latest essays appear in Sky Island Journal, Pollux and the Journal of Expressive Writing. RUNNER UP - Maureen Sherbondy
“The Drowning”
Maureen Sherbondy’s latest poetry collection is Dancing with Dali. Her first young adult novel, Lucky Brilliant, was published last year. Her work has appeared in Southeast Review, Stone Canoe, Calyx, and other journals. Maureen lives in Durham, North Carolina. Website: www.maureensherbondy.com
